Abstract
Only snapshot data necessary for monitoring faults are collected from machine such as vehicles, allowing faults to be more accurately monitored, and the amount of data and the memory storage volume at a monitoring station to be reduced. The values of a plurality of (A), (B), (C), and (D) operating parameters (engine rotational speed, lever operating position, vehicle speed, and tractive force) which change during the operation of the machine are sequentially detected for each machine. The fault detection history data are thus updated every time a fault (drop in engine oil pressure, overheating) is detected during the operation of the machine. Thus, when a fault (drop in engine oil pressure) is detected during the operation of the machine, it is determined on the basis of the history data whether or not to send to the monitoring station the sequential values of the operating parameters ((A) engine rotational speed, (B) lever operating position, (C) vehicle speed, (D) tractive force) from within a prescribed period of time (from 10 min. before to 5 min. after) around the point in time t0 at which the fault was detected.
